Yolo County basic income program provided reprieve from poverty but not financial independence

The Yolo County basic income program provided a monthly stipend of $1,289 per month to 76 mostly single-parent families, helping them gain housing, food, and general wellbeing. Participants reported reduced stress levels and improved parenting skills, but faced challenges in achieving long-term financial stability.

Candidate breast cancer drug overloads tumors with “surge” of toxic lipids

The experimental drug DH20931 targets triple-negative breast cancer by triggering a surge in fat-like molecules called ceramides, overwhelming cancer cells with toxic fats. In lab experiments, the drug made standard chemotherapy more effective, reducing the dose needed to kill cancer cells by about fivefold.

Field tests: Clearing aisle islands boosts sales

A study by University of Innsbruck researchers found that removing secondary product displays in crowded supermarket aisles increases sales by 11.5% due to increased browsing and interactions. Shopping carts amplify the negative effects, making narrow aisles feel tighter and reducing perceived control.

Yoga practice could reduce blood pressure in people with obesity

A recent study published in PLOS Global Public Health found that practicing yoga can significantly decrease blood pressure in individuals with overweight or obesity. The meta-analysis of 30 studies showed that systolic and diastolic blood pressure were lowered by an average of 4.35 mmHg and 2.06 mmHg, respectively.

Wildfire-driven deforestation rates in California among highest in world

A study by University of California, Davis found that California's conifer forests have lost between 6% and 11% of their area over the past three decades due to wildfires. Reforestation efforts are not keeping pace with the losses, with only about 1% of deforested Forest Service lands being replanted between 2016 and 2023.
